Run ID:153308

提交时间:2026-05-14 15:38:51

#include <iostream> #include <string> #include <algorithm> using namespace std; int main() { int n; cin >> n; while (n--) { string s; cin >> s; int a[1000]; int cnt = 0; int cur = 0; bool ok = false; for (int i = 0; i < s.size(); i++) { if (s[i] != '5') { cur = cur * 10 + s[i] - '0'; ok = true; } else { if (ok) { a[cnt++] = cur; cur = 0; ok = false; } } } if (ok) { a[cnt++] = cur; } sort(a, a + cnt); for (int i = 0; i < cnt; i++) { if (i > 0) cout << " "; cout << a[i]; } cout << endl; } return 0; }